DESCRIPTION
In the "Replace Missing Sensors" dialog, if a sensor name is too long, the text
will be cut off making it indistinguishable from other sensors, which can make
it tedious to try and replace them correctly

STEPS TO REPRODUCE
1. Import a page with known missing sensors (I used this as an example -
https://store.kde.org/p/2135725)
2. Navigate to the imported page
3. Click "Fix" on the warning about missing sensors

OBSERVED RESULT
The sensor names are cut off 

EXPECTED RESULT
The sensor names should be readable so that a user can match them up correctly
